How to get here
The most common way to travel to Narvik is by air, but it’s also possible to travel by rail or bus. A large number of cruise ships call to Narvik annually.

By air
The national airport Harstad/ Narvik Airport Evenes (EVE)is located about 57 km from Narvik town center and 50 minutes by car. There are six or more daily flights from Oslo (OSL) to Evenes (EVE). Express buses to Narvik correspond to most of the flight arrivals from Oslo.
The domestic airport Bardufoss Airport (BDU) is located about 102 km from Narvik town centre and 1.5 hours by car.
The airport in Kiruna (SWE) is located about 187 km from Narvik town center and ca. 2.5 hours by car.

By Train
Train from Stockholm (Sweden) takes you directly to Narvik. The train ride with the night train from Stockholm to Narvik, is said to be one of the most impressive trips in all of Europe. It takes 18 hours to get through the incredible nature of middle Sweden, up to the north of Lappland and across the mountains to Norway. More information and tickets at Vy's website.

By Bus
Long-distance bus services connect Narvik with Bodø, Lofoten and Tromsø all year. Bus from Tromsø (4h) Lofoten Islands (3h 45m) Bodø (6h).
